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

FAAC and FAAD2-based single track constant bit rate audio realtime coding and decoding error correcting method

A technology of fixed bit rate and error correction method, applied in speech analysis, error prevention, instruments, etc., can solve the problems of complex transmission control mechanism, poor robustness, and increased system resources, so as to achieve no increase in system resources and robustness. high effect

Inactive Publication Date: 2011-02-09
BEIHANG UNIV
View PDF7 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] In the real-time encoding and decoding system, during the transmission of the AAC data frame, bit errors inevitably occur, and the cyclic redundancy check code is used for error detection. If a bit error occurs, the AAC encoder must retransmit the erroneous data frame. Guarantee uninterrupted decoding output audio, but using this method will lead to complex transmission control mechanism, increased system resources, and poor robustness

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• FAAC and FAAD2-based single track constant bit rate audio realtime coding and decoding error correcting method
  • FAAC and FAAD2-based single track constant bit rate audio realtime coding and decoding error correcting method
  • FAAC and FAAD2-based single track constant bit rate audio realtime coding and decoding error correcting method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0025] The technical solution of the present invention will be further described below in conjunction with the accompanying drawings.

[0026] The invention provides an audio real-time codec error correction method based on FAAC and FAAD2 monophonic fixed bit rate. See attached figure 1 , the error correction method mainly includes: the encoder performs Hamming encoding (110) on the fixed (101) and variable (102) frame headers respectively, and ID_SCE (103), SCETAG (104), global scale factor (105) and ID_END (109) is grouped into one group and carries out Hamming encoding, side information (106) Hamming encoding, data area (107) is grouped according to the size of filling data area (108), and each group of data is carried out Hamming encoding; From each The check digit data is separated from the Hamming code, and stored in the filling data area (108) in sequence; the decoder obtains the check bit data from the filling data area, and performs Hamming code error checking and er...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a free advanced audio coder(FAAC) and AAC audio decoder (FAAD2)-based single track constant bit rate audio realtime coding and decoding error correcting method, which mainly comprises that: a coder performs Hamming coding of fixed and variable frame headers, the Hamming coding of ID-SCE, SCETAG, a global scale factor and ID-END in a group, and Hamming coding of side information, packs a data area according to the size of a padding data area, performs Hamming coding of each data packet, separates check bit data from Hamming codes and stores the check bit data in the padding data area in turn; and a decoder acquires check bit data from the packing data area and performs the Hamming code error checking and correcting of corresponding data bits. On the premise of ensuring the structural integrity of an advanced audio coding (AAC) frame, the method has the capability of correcting errors of AAC data frames.

Description

technical field [0001] The invention relates to an audio real-time coding and decoding error correction method based on FAAC and FAAD2 monophonic fixed bit rate. The error correction method has error correction capability for AAC data frames and belongs to the field of communication. Background technique [0002] Advanced Audio Coding (AAC) is a new generation of perceptual audio compression codec technology developed on the basis of MP3. This technology combines the advantages of various mainstream audio codec technologies. Well, the codec process is highly modular and the channel configuration is flexible. [0003] In the real-time encoding and decoding system, during the transmission of the AAC data frame, bit errors inevitably occur, and the cyclic redundancy check code is used for error detection. If a bit error occurs, the AAC encoder must retransmit the erroneous data frame. Guarantee the uninterruptedness of the decoded output audio, but adopting this method will le...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G10L19/00H04L1/00G10L19/005
Inventor 毛峡邵伟国
Owner BEIHANG UNIV
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products